The new 'Bionic Woman' preview
Plot: Struggling as a bartender and surrogate mom to her teen-aged sister, Jaime Sommers didn't think life could get much harder. But when a devastating car accident leaves her at death's door, Jaime's only hope of survival is through a cutting-edge, top-secret technology that comes at a hefty price.
With a whole new existence and a debt to repay, Jaime must figure out how to use her extraordinary abilities for good, while weighing the personal sacrifices she will have to make. Ultimately, it's Jaime's journey of self-discovery and inner strength that will help her embrace her new life as...The Bionic Woman.
Preview Comments: The editing for the preview is kind of cheesy at points, but despite that the show actually looks pretty cool. I can't help but make a "Michelle Ryan is no Lindsey Wagner" comment (although in Ryan's defenseit's hard to be as hot as the Wagner ... see *fondly remembers teenage girl!crush*) but she looks like she can be pretty bad-ass, and she does an awesome 'almost cry'.
Plus, Katee 'motherfrakking' Sackhoff shows up in the trailer as Jaime's nemsis, the first bionic woman. And in true 'motherfrakking' Sackhoff style, she manages to make the "ta-da" completely awesome!
They show also stars, Miguel Ferrer, Molly Price, Mark "Badger/Romo Lampkin" Shepard, and Mae "Anne Beal" Whitman doing a very good, as Joy from "My Name as Earl" would put it, "deaf accent".
